[The treatment of abdominal evisceration using the wire technique (author's transl)]
Abstract:
The insertion of wires in the preventive and curative treatment of abdominal evisceration is a variety of atraumatic open full-thickness sutures which are easy to carry out and particularly effective. In preventive treatment, they facilitate abdominal closure and avoid the risk of evisceration when large areas of skin are involved. In curative treatment, they form an abdominal "buckle" with the equal distribution of increased pressure over a large area, avoiding pulling on the sutures.
